Partilhar via


Interface IVsBroadcastMessageEvents

 

Transmite mensagens aos clientes que registrado para ser notificado sobre eventos dentro do ambiente.

Namespace:   Microsoft.VisualStudio.Shell.Interop
Assembly:  Microsoft.VisualStudio.Shell.Interop (em Microsoft.VisualStudio.Shell.Interop.dll)

Sintaxe

[InterfaceTypeAttribute(1)]
[GuidAttribute("FC5EF273-DCE3-4DBB-AEE3-F54F91F00286")]
public interface IVsBroadcastMessageEvents
[InterfaceTypeAttribute(1)]
[GuidAttribute("FC5EF273-DCE3-4DBB-AEE3-F54F91F00286")]
public interface class IVsBroadcastMessageEvents
[<InterfaceTypeAttribute(1)>]
[<GuidAttribute("FC5EF273-DCE3-4DBB-AEE3-F54F91F00286")>]
type IVsBroadcastMessageEvents = interface end
<InterfaceTypeAttribute(1)>
<GuidAttribute("FC5EF273-DCE3-4DBB-AEE3-F54F91F00286")>
Public Interface IVsBroadcastMessageEvents

Métodos

Nome Descrição
System_CAPS_pubmethod OnBroadcastMessage(UInt32, IntPtr, IntPtr)

Acionado quando uma mensagem é transmitida para a janela do ambiente.

Comentários

Um cliente obtém as notificações de eventos dentro do ambiente por meio de AdviseBroadcastMessages e desconectar-se por meio de UnadviseBroadcastMessages.

Consulte as ilustrações da implementação e/ou chamada desta interface no exemplo de Solution Extender.

Consulte também

Namespace Microsoft.VisualStudio.Shell.Interop

Retornar ao topo